Today it was interesting to find the Baltic States – Latvia, Estonia, and Lithuania connected to the electricity supplied via Finland, Sweden, and Poland after disconnecting from Russia.
"We did it!" Edgars Rinkevics, the president of Latvia, posted on X.
How it happened was that on Saturday all the remaining transmission lines between the Baltic States and Russia, Belarus, and the Russian enclave of Kaliningrad, wedged between EU members Lithuania and Poland and the sea were switched off one by one.
First, it was Lithuania with a specially-made 9-meter tall clock in downtown Vilnius, the capital counted down the final seconds, then Latvia a few minutes later, and finally Estonia.
